Project Knitwell is an organization that uses the simple act of knitting to improve wellbeing and create connections for people facing challenging circumstances.

Participants in our programs range from hospital patients and caregivers to people experiencing homelessness and refugees. All of them find solace and support in the rhythmic repetition of knitting and the camaraderie of shared learning.

We have programs at over 18 sites in the Washington, DC area and each year our volunteers spend around 2000 hours working with 1800 participants.

Project Knitwell brings the comfort and community of knitting to those who need it most.
